If you suspect you have ADHD You should ask your GP for the referral to the health professional who performs ADHD assessments for adults. These professionals could be neuropsychologists, psychiatrists, or psychologists.
The process of diagnosing ADHD involves a thorough interview that examines your past including your social and family history. The healthcare professional should also identify evidence of impairment, such as losing your job due to ADHD symptoms or being in financial trouble due to reckless spending habits.

If you choose to use an independent provider to evaluate your adult ADHD ensure that you inform your GP that you are exercising the Right to Choose. This will speed up the process since some doctors are reluctant to refer patients to private providers for an assessment, especially if it is needed for an urgent situation. The good news is that the majority of the Right to Choose providers offer a letter template you can download, which will explain the steps to do and where to send it.

A healthcare professional who is educated and experienced in neurodevelopmental disorders, like ADHD, will be able to diagnose ADHD. A psychiatrist will look over your complete medical history and discuss in detail your symptoms. They will also review any questionnaires you've completed or provided and, if needed conduct an examination of your body.
This test will ask you questions regarding your current symptoms, how they've impacted your life and relationships and whether you've been diagnosed with other mental health conditions. This could include tests such as IQ and memory tests, inkblots and ADHD symptoms self-reports. Sometimes, puzzles or timed challenges may also be included. Your specialist will then examine the results of these tests and conduct a thorough conversation with you to understand your unique experiences.
If you've been diagnosed for other ailments Your doctor will take into consideration how these may impact on the way you experience symptoms of ADHD and will advise you accordingly. For instance, depression or anxiety could be like ADHD and often co-exist with the condition. Based on the nature of your symptoms, your psychiatrist may suggest that you undergo an occupational health examination or submit a report to the DVLA (Driver and Vehicle Licensing Agency). If you have been diagnosed with ADHD, it is important to notify the DVLA if your driving ability has been affected. You can drive if have ADHD under control in the majority of instances. However, it's important to notify the DVLA when there are any changes.
